Where does “eşsiz” come from?

eşsiz (Turkish) comes from Ottoman Turkish اشسز, from Ottoman Turkish ـسز, from Proto-Turkic *-siŕ — Used to form adjectives or nouns denoting the non-possession of a thing or quality; -less.

eşsiz (Turkish): unique; inimitable
